[−][src]Struct heaparray::naive_rc::generic::RcArray
RcArray
is a generic, implementation-agnositc array. It contains
logic for enforcing type safety.
The type parameters are, in order:
A: A struct that acts as a reference to an array.
R: A reference-counting structure, that wraps the label.
E: The elements that this array contains.
L: The label that is associated with this array.
Implementation
Reference counting is done by a struct stored directly next to the data; this means that this struct is a single pointer indirection from its underlying data.

impl<A, R, E, L> CopyMap<usize, E> for RcArray<A, R, E, L> where
A: LabelledArray<E, R> + BaseArrayRef,
R: RefCounter<L>,
[src]
A: LabelledArray<E, R> + BaseArrayRef,
R: RefCounter<L>,
fn get(&self, key: usize) -> Option<&E>
[src]
Get a reference into this array. Returns None
if:
- The index given is out-of-bounds
fn get_mut(&mut self, key: usize) -> Option<&mut E>
[src]
Get a mutable reference into this array. Returns None
if:
- The array is referenced by another pointer
- The index given is out-of-bounds
fn insert(&mut self, key: usize, value: E) -> Option<E>
[src]
Insert an element into this array. Returns None
if:
- The array is referenced by another pointer
- The index given is out-of-bounds
- There was nothing in the slot previously
